Stop on-the-job overthinking and reclaim your evenings—without mindfulness exercises—even if you spend weekends replaying every meeting in your head.

Do you look calm to your colleagues while privately spiraling over vague feedback?

Reread a simple email ten times before sending?

Lie awake at 2 a.m. replaying a minor conversation?

Stop Overthinking at Work is the practical blueprint you need. Drawing on over a decade in corporate communications and operations, Nathan Soren skips generic advice like breathing deeply or thinking positive. Workplace overthinking isn't an anxiety problem—it's a decision-architecture problem. You'll get concrete, office-tested rules and scripts to stay composed on the outside while protecting your mental energy on the inside.

This audiobook includes:

  • The five workplace loops that steal your sleep, and how to shut each one down
  • The Single-Pass Rule for sending routine emails without second-guessing
  • A Good-Enough Threshold so you decide faster and move on
  • The Five-Minute Debrief that quiets the post-meeting replay
  • Word-for-word scripts for decoding ambiguous feedback and terse messages
  • The Work Shutdown Protocol to leave work at work
  • A day-by-day guide to building your own thinking system

Most professionals assume they can't stop because they're "naturally anxious" or "lack confidence." This system asks neither. Pre-made rules close the loops for you, stopping spirals before they start.
